Abstract

Described are catalyst compositions, oxidizable-gas burner systems, methods of oxidizing oxidizable gas, and methods of preparing catalyst compositions and oxidizable-gas burner systems.

Claims (15)

1. An oxidizable-gas burner system comprising:

an oxidizable gas source,

a heat source, and

a catalyst system comprising:

(i) an activating nanoporous support medium selected from the group consisting of an oxide of zirconium, an oxide of titanium, an oxide of manganese, an oxide of cerium optionally further comprising a mixture with aluminum oxide, and an oxide of a mixture of titanium, zirconium and manganese; and

(ii) a palladium metal physically vapor deposited on the support medium;

wherein the oxidizable gas source is in fluid communication with the heat source and the catalyst system is situated proximate to the heat source, wherein the palladium metal is present at from 0.001 to 5 weight percent pal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ium.

2. The system according to claim 1 , wherein the palladium metal is present from 0.04 to 0.5 weight percent pal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ium.

3. The system according to claim 1 , wherein at least 95 percent by weight of the pal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ium is deposited on the surface of the support medium.

4. The system according to claim 3 , wherein at least 99.5 percent by weight of the pal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ium is deposited on the surface of the support medium.

5. The system according to claim 1 , wherein the palladium metal has an oxidation state selected from +2 and +4.

6. A method comprising:

providing a system according to claim 1 , and

contacting the catalyst system with an oxidizable gas, wherein the T50 is below 400° C. and the palladium is present in an amount of from 0.001 to 5 weight percent pal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ium.

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the palladium is present in an amount of from 0.04 to 0.5 weight percent palladium based on the total weight of the palladium and the support medium.
